2016 Hyundai Tucson Driver Window Not Working: Troubleshooting Guide
The 2016 Hyundai Tucson has been reported to have issues with power windows, particularly affecting the driver’s side window. This guide aims to help Tucson owners identify and resolve these problems effectively.
Common Symptoms of Window Malfunction
When the driver window in a 2016 Hyundai Tucson stops working, owners may notice several symptoms:
- No Movement: The window does not move when the switch is pressed.
- Hearing Clicks: Users may hear a clicking sound without any movement of the window, indicating potential motor or regulator issues.
- Intermittent Functionality: The window may work sporadically, suggesting electrical or mechanical faults.
- Express Close Feature Failure: The window may stop short of closing fully or open unexpectedly, often linked to limit switch issues.

Potential Causes of Window Issues
Understanding the underlying causes can help in diagnosing the problem:
- Blown Fuse: A common issue that can prevent the window from functioning. Always check the relevant fuses first.
- Faulty Window Motor: If the motor is defective, it will not operate the window even if the switch is functional.
- Window Regulator Failure: The regulator is responsible for moving the window up and down. Mechanical failures here are common.
- Wiring Problems: Damaged or loose wiring, especially in the door hinge area, can interrupt power to the window system.
- Switch Malfunction: The window switch itself may fail, leading to an inability to control the window.
Step-by-Step Troubleshooting Guide
To troubleshoot and potentially fix the driver window issue in your 2016 Hyundai Tucson, follow these steps:
Step 1: Check the Fuses
Inspect the fuses related to the power windows. Replace any blown fuses found during this check.
Step 2: Test the Window Switch
Press the switch and listen for any sounds. If there’s no response, consider testing with a multimeter or replacing the switch.
Step 3: Listen for Motor Activity
While pressing the switch, listen for the motor. If you hear it running but see no movement, focus on checking the regulator.
Step 4: Inspect Wiring Connections
Remove the door panel and examine wiring connections for any visible damage or disconnections.
Step 5: Check and Replace Window Regulator
If mechanical failure is suspected, replacing the window regulator may be necessary. Follow detailed instructions or consult a professional if needed.
Step 6: Consult a Professional Mechanic
If all else fails, seek help from a qualified mechanic who can provide a more thorough diagnosis and repair.
FAQs About 2016 Hyundai Tucson Driver Window Issues
- What should I do if my driver window works intermittently?
Check for wiring issues or consider replacing the window switch. - How can I tell if my window regulator is broken?
If you hear motor noise but see no movement, it’s likely a regulator issue. - Is it expensive to repair a broken window regulator?
Repair costs can vary; however, many owners report high repair bills due to part quality.
